Ensuring Proper Specimen Collection in Medical Labs and Phlebotomy Services: Key Steps and Strategies

Summary

  • Proper training and education of phlebotomists and lab technicians are crucial for ensuring accurate specimen collection.
  • Using proper techniques and following standard protocols can help prevent errors and contamination during the pre-analytical phase.
  • Effective communication and collaboration between healthcare professionals in the lab and clinical settings are essential for ensuring proper specimen collection.

Proper specimen collection is a vital component of the laboratory testing process. Errors or contamination during the pre-analytical phase can lead to inaccurate Test Results, potentially impacting patient care. In the United States, medical labs and phlebotomy services play a crucial role in healthcare delivery, and ensuring proper specimen collection is essential. This article will discuss the steps that can be taken to ensure proper specimen collection during the pre-analytical phase in medical labs and phlebotomy in the United States.

Proper Training and Education

One of the most important steps in ensuring proper specimen collection is to provide adequate training and education to phlebotomists and lab technicians. Proper training ensures that healthcare professionals understand the importance of specimen collection and are familiar with the correct techniques and procedures.

Training programs for phlebotomists should include:

  1. Instruction on Venipuncture techniques
  2. Training on how to properly handle and label specimens
  3. Education on infection control practices

Furthermore, ongoing education and training should be provided to keep healthcare professionals updated on the latest guidelines and best practices for specimen collection.

Standard Protocols and Guidelines

Following standard protocols and guidelines is essential for ensuring proper specimen collection. The Clinical and Laboratory Standards Institute (CLSI) and other regulatory bodies provide guidelines for specimen collection, handling, and transportation.

Key components of standard protocols include:

  1. Proper patient identification to prevent mix-ups
  2. Using the correct tubes and containers for different types of specimens
  3. Adhering to proper collection techniques to prevent contamination

By following these standard protocols and guidelines, healthcare professionals can minimize the risk of errors and ensure the integrity of the specimens collected.

Effective Communication and Collaboration

Effective communication and collaboration between healthcare professionals in the lab and clinical settings are crucial for ensuring proper specimen collection. Clear communication ensures that everyone involved in the specimen collection process understands their roles and responsibilities.

Key points for effective communication include:

  1. Ensuring that all staff are aware of any special requirements for specific tests
  2. Communicating any issues or concerns with specimen collection promptly
  3. Documenting all communication regarding specimen collection for future reference

Collaboration between phlebotomists, lab technicians, and Healthcare Providers is essential for ensuring that specimens are collected correctly and handled appropriately throughout the testing process.

Quality Control and Monitoring

Implementing Quality Control measures and monitoring practices are essential for ensuring proper specimen collection. Regular audits and checks can help identify any issues or errors in the specimen collection process.

Quality Control measures should include:

  1. Periodic reviews of collection procedures and protocols
  2. Reviewing and analyzing error reports to identify areas for improvement
  3. Monitoring staff performance and providing feedback and remedial training when necessary

By implementing Quality Control measures and monitoring practices, medical labs can maintain high standards of specimen collection and ensure accurate Test Results for patient care.

Conclusion

Proper specimen collection during the pre-analytical phase is essential for accurate Test Results and quality patient care. By following the steps outlined in this article, including proper training, adherence to standard protocols, effective communication, and Quality Control measures, healthcare professionals can ensure that specimens are collected correctly and handled appropriately. Taking these steps will help to minimize errors and contamination, ultimately improving the quality and reliability of laboratory testing in the United States.
